    Yeah, but you rarely have a season where you need as few as 8, 9 or 10 players. We've seen the need for more depth each of the past 3 seasons. Whether it be injury or a player not living up to his end of the bargain. Downplay the competition factor if you want, but you need it for a number of reasons. Iron sharpens iron. The more of that you can provide, the better. And when you don't have cupboards stocked full of dudes that can fill it up, having someone who can threaten to take playing time is a powerful motivator. I think we've carried an extra scholarship into the season every year under Miles. Only once have we filled it with a mid-season transfer. I'm excited for his potential, but I'd love it if at least occasionally that scholarship had been filled. Someone like a Tre'Shawn Thurman would have been a perfect use of that open scholie. There are plenty of in-state guys that could have been the 13th guy on the roster. That doesn't seem unreasonable to me.

    Tired of hearing the self imposed sanctions thing and people whining about not being able to get 13 scholarship players. A rotation is 8, 9, 10 players at the very most. Say what you want about competition in practice blah blah blah. We want the most firepower we can possibly have within that playing rotation. Miles has made clear his strategy on optimizing potential to add firepower to the rotation. That is to leave a spot open for a mid season transfer because guys in the spring who haven't signed yet are overvalued and recruited by everyone who needs a guy. In other words, they usually aren't as good as advertised and odds of landing them are small. Adding a 13th just to add a 13th does no good. It's not like we are turning 5 star recruits away and saying sorry we have to leave a spot open in case there's a mid season transfer we want. We usually have reeled in the best of the recruits available who want to come here and are scratching and clawing for guy number 12. So it's not like adding a 13th guy who is questionable at this level does us any good.
